Two-car crash on I-20 with extinguished vehicle fire, Kershaw County SC
Emergency crews responded to a two-car crash on I-20 westbound near mile marker 93. One vehicle had caught fire but the flames were extinguished. Injury status and entrapment details were unknown at the time.
